Filipino Voice Data Labelers often use tools like Audacity, Praat, and specialized annotation software such as Verito and Labelbox. These tools assist in accurately labeling audio data for machine learning applications and ensure high-quality transcriptions.
Offshore Voice Data Labelers implement rigorous quality assurance processes, including double-checking label accuracy and maintaining consistency across samples. They often follow industry standards and utilize feedback loops to continuously improve labeling accuracy.
Yes, many Filipino Voice Data Labelers are multilingual and can handle audio data labeling in various languages, including English, Filipino, and regional dialects. This versatility makes them suitable for diverse projects requiring nuanced language skills.
Turnaround times for projects may vary based on audio length and complexity, but Filipino Voice Data Labelers generally offer quick turnaround times. They are used to working under tight deadlines and can often deliver labeled data within 24 to 48 hours.
Outsourced Voice Data Labelers typically collaborate with teams through project management tools like Trello, Asana, or Slack. This setup allows for seamless communication, feedback sharing, and tracking progress, ensuring alignment with project goals.

Your primary responsibility revolves around audio annotation, which involves meticulously labeling sound data according to the specifications provided. You utilize specialized software tools, such as Praat or Audacity, to segment and annotate audio clips accurately. Working through a series of audio samples, you identify and mark various sound features, including speech, background noise, and relevant phonetic elements. Maintaining consistency and accuracy throughout this process is essential to ensure the data's usefulness for subsequent training of voice models.
